I wanted to also mention that I have had some difficulty breathing also.
I am paralised from T2. My problem has been breathing to shallow. This
has been explained to me that it is partly because of the way the
muscles in my chest are not being made to expand as well. My PT has me
to lay with a couple towels rolled up together, like a newspaper would
look, placed along the spine just below my shoulders. (I'm laying on my
back) I will lay this way for only for 5 minutes 2 times a day. This
helps these muscles to expand and makes it easier to taka a deeper
breath. You do have to keep doing this every day. I has really helped
me so you may want to encourage her to try this. If we don't expand our
lungs we are setting ourselves up for worse problems.
